Srinagar, Dec. 8 -- Srinagar, we were repeatedly told, has been transformed into a "smart city." Ironically, it was never as congested, chaotic, or directionless as it became after that declaration. If "smartness" is measured by how many minutes it takes a common citizen to crawl through a two-kilometre patch of road, then yes, we have indeed made unprecedented progress. The city that once breathed in long, uninterrupted corridors - from Dalgate to Batamaloo, from Karan Nagar to Khanyar - now gasps for space like an asthmatic trapped in a smoke chamber.
